This lower unit is a 2 bedroom apartment with one bath including a washer and dryer. The kitchen is fully stocked to make that perfect meal.
The home is yours to enjoy along with front and back yard space. Sit on the bench for two in the front yard to enjoy the incredible view of Pikes Peak. Backyard has your own private picnic table for barbecues with friends and family or just relaxing with a good book.
The home is only 1 mile from the downtown, with great shops, restaurants and bars. In the winter you can ice skate at the city park. Then just another mile to the west is the Old Colorado City downtown. Another place with great restaurants and shops.

My home is centrally located in the downtown zip code of Colorado Springs. Its only less then a mile from the downtown street of Tejon. Lots of good restaurants and local shops. My home is also 3 miles from the Old town of Colorado Springs. In the spring and summer there is a Farmers Market across from the library. The home is less then a mile from the largest park (Memorial Park) in Colorado Springs. You will find a skate board park, a path around the lake and lots of grass to play any games. Memorial Park has 4th of July fireworks and the Labor Day Balloon festival. You'll see the balloons from the front and backyard. You will also find a indoor bike track and a YMCA pool and workout center. There is so much to do in Colorado Springs and my home is close to all the attractions.
